Clewus Vines 1919 - 1992

Clewus Vines of Haleyville, Winston County, AL was born on May 3, 1919, and died at age 73 years old on August 5, 1992.

In 1940, Clewus was 21 years old when in July, Billboard published its first Music Popularity Chart. Top recordings of the year were Tommy Dorsey's "I'll Never Smile Again" (vocal Frank Sinatra) - 12 weeks at the top, Bing Crosby's "Only Forever" - 9 weeks at the top, and Artie Shaw's "Frenesi" - 12 weeks at the top.
